  2. Files & Folders View as medium or large Icons

    To assist you better, we would suggest that you try to follow the steps below:

    • Open File Explorer.
    • Once you are viewing a folder, right click an empty space within the File Explorer window and select View from the dialogue menu, then choose Large or any icon you wanted to use. Alternatively, you can use the following shortcut keys on the keyboard to
      change your View settings:
    • CTRL + SHIFT + 1 Extra Large
    • CTRL + SHIFT + 2 Large icons
    • CTRL + SHIFT + 3 Medium Icons
    • CTRL + SHIFT + 4 Small Icons
    • CTRL + SHIFT + 5 List
    • CTRL + SHIFT + 6 Details
    • CTRL + SHIFT + 7 Tiles
    • CTRL + SHIFT + 8 Content
    3. Once you have the view set, you can make it the default view for

    every folder.

    4. Click Apply, then click OK.

    Update us on the result.
